the 34 cookies of Christmas: day 29

Our twenty-ninth cookie creation of Christmas 2006 is one which we lovingly refer to as "dog bones"-- no due to their taste, of course, but rather their unique shape. These crunchy log-shaped cookies are packed full of chocolate chunks and infused with Tahitian vanilla paste. After baking, the ends are dipped in tempered Belgian bittersweet chocolate, and rolled in an assortment of toasted and chopped nuts. This year, we used toasted slivered almonds to finish the bones, but in past years we have used walnuts, pecans, hazelnuts... even toasted coconut. All in all, these simple cookies are a favorite of humans and dogs alike... although not nearly as inviting to the latter group as our previously described cappuccino flats (see day 24 of the 34 cookies of Christmas!)...
